Thirty One years of Detecting over 300,000 holes dug and I finely dug my first Gold Coin. Found on 3-28-09. It is a 1878 US Five Dollar Gold coin found with my new E-Trac detector. It was like all other signals when digging old foundations, you get a good signal you dig it... But this one was different, NO junk, No shell casing, No Copper, No Lead but a wedge of soil with this gold edge sticking out the side. I could see the gold but in the past I have been fooled by heavy Gilt golden Buttons. I could see the reeding on the edge of the item. I knew now it was a gold coin. As I removed the dirt I was hoping it was a $10.00 gold coin, then I was hoping it was a 1700 gold coin, I then so carefully removed the dirt but I did not scrap the dirt off I picked it off not wanting to cause damage to the surface. I did manage to hit it slightly on the edge with a shovel but you can only tell when holding the coin in the light you can see the new scrapes. Wow 31 years , thousands of holes and when you least expect it .. A Gold 1878 $5.00 coin appears in a hole that should have been just another target ,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,, You never know... !!! Bucky
